APJ ABDUL KALAM TECHNOLOGICAL UNIVERSITY
Fifth Semester B.Tech Degree Regular and Supplementary Examination December 2022 (2019 Scheme)

Course Code: ECT 301


Course Name: LINEAR INTEGRATED CIRCUITS
Max. Marks: 100 Duration: 3 Hours
PART A
(Answer all questions; each question carries 3 marks) Marks

1 What are the ideal characteristics of an op-amp.? 3


2 Define Slew rate? Explain its significance. 3
3 Discuss the concept of virtual ground. 3
4 State how practical integrator is different from simple integrator circuit, with 3
relevant sketches.
5 Draw the circuit of an op-amp monostable multivibrator and write down the 3
expression of time period.
6 What are the advantages of active filters over passive filters? 3
7 Design a free-running multivibrator using 555 for a frequency of 1 KHz and a 3
duty cycle of 60%. Choose C= 0.1µF.
8 Mention three applications of PLL. 3
9 Explain the features and functional block diagram of IC 723. 3
10 List out DAC specifications. 3
PART B
(Answer one full question from each module, each question carries 14 marks)

Module -1
11 a) Derive CMRR, input resistance and output resistance of a dual input balanced 7
output differential amplifier configuration.
b) How a constant current bias circuit can be used to improve the CMRR of a 7
differential amplifier?
12 a) Draw the block diagram of an op-amp and explain the functions of each block. 7
b) Draw the equivalent circuit of an op-amp and explain the voltage transfer 7
characteristics of an op-amp.

Module -2
13 a) Design the circuits to obtain the following output, Vo. (i) Vo = (5V1) 8
𝑉1 +𝑉2 +𝑉3
(ii) Vo= V1+ 2V2 (iii) 𝑉𝑜 = −( ) (iv) Vo = - 2V1- 5V2
3
b) Derive the following characteristics of voltage shunt amplifier: (i) Closed loop 6
voltage gain (ii)Input resistance (iii) Output resistance (iv)Bandwidth
14 a) What is a logarithmic amplifier? Draw the circuit and derive the transfer function 7
of a logarithmic amplifier.
b) Draw and explain the circuit of a voltage to current converter with grounded 7
load and derive its transfer function.
Module -3
15 a) With the help of circuit diagram explain the operation of RC phase shift 10
oscillator using op-amp. Derive the expression for frequency of oscillation and
the minimum gain requirement for sustained oscillation.
b) Design a first order low pass filter with the following specifications 4
(i)-3dB frequency 1 KHz , (ii) DC gain 20dB. Choose C= 0.01µF.
16 a) Design a circuit to generate a triangular waveform of 7VP-P at 1 KHz using an op- 7
amp having saturation voltage of ±14 V and draw the waveforms also.
b) Derive the equation for the frequency of oscillation of an opamp astable 7
multivibrator with the help of circuit diagram and waveforms.
Module -4
17 a) Draw the functional block diagram of 566 VCO and explain its operation. 7
b) Explain the operation of PLL. What is its lock range and capture range. 7
18 a) List the features of Timer IC 555 4
b) Draw the internal diagram of a 555 timer and explain its working as a 10
monostable multivibrator and derive the expression for its pulse-width.
Module -5
19 a) Discuss how the IC 723 can be used as high voltage regulator with current limit 7
and with current fold back.
b) Draw and explain the working of successive approximation type ADC. 7
20 a) With neat circuit diagram explain the working of a 3-bit flash ADC. 7
b) Explain the circuit of a 4-bit R-2R ladder DAC. 7
